CityPulse is a policy intelligence platform designed to help governments simulate public reaction before real-world rollout. It combines real-time data ingestion, LLM-driven reasoning, and large-scale swarm simulation to model how policies may influence sentiment, behavior, and city-scale response. The system was built as a full-stack product with production-minded architecture, fast simulation cycles, and a clear path toward municipal use.

Highlights
- —Engineered a microservices-based platform to predict public reaction to government policies with 92% accuracy on validated rollout datasets
- —Deployed a 1,000-agent swarm simulation completing in 30–45 seconds to model crowd and sentiment dynamics at city scale
- —Integrated IBM watsonx and Claude API for agent reasoning, interpretation, and large-scale behavioral simulation
- —Built a real-time dashboard and REST API layer for scenario testing before policy deployment
- —Designed the system around practical deployment potential, with a direct path toward municipal pilot programs
